In the summer Sculpture courses will be organized in the studio’s of the sculptor Antonius Willems at La Montée in Richemont in the southwest of France. The courses last for one week and are designed for beginners as well as advanced level, with the personal support of an professional artist and experienced teacher. You will work in a small group, which personalizes and intensifies your education.

Materials and techniques will be explained to beginners. You will work with French limestone, alabaster or modeling wax or clay. At the advanced level, the focus is on the development of your personal style and to deepen an outlook on your own visual language. You will sculpt in wood, French limestone, alabaster, marble, granite, modeling wax or clay or welding steel. You will learn how to work with specific materials, professional and specialized tools and machines. A extensive range of modern tools are available on site.

Site
La Montée is a Cognac farm from the 16th century which is located in the village of Richemont alongside the Antenne River, 3 km north of the medieval town of Cognac.

Stay
In the vicinity of La Montée you can choose from numerous accommodations like hotels, B&B’s or camping’s. Once your registration form and first payment are received, we’ll send you a complete list of localities and accommodation. You’ll have to make your own choice, we can help you with the reservation.

Surroundings
The ‘Pays de Cognac’ is known for its scenic landscape covered with vineyards, as if time has stood still. The region has a sunny micro-climate with many hours of sun. With the sea not too far away, more gentle temperatures are the norm. This inspiring region is one of the quietest places in France. It is a marvelous location for hiking, cycling, horse riding, golf, swimming and sailing. In Cherves-Richemont you’ll find the Chateau Chesnel. A 5 minute drive from La Montée brings you to the ancient part of the town of Cognac with the old cellars of the well known cognac brands, to the ‘Valois de François I’ Castle, to ‘des Arts de Cognac’ Museum, to sunny terraces and a choice of excellent restaurants. In Sainte-Brice (10 km) you’ll find a beautiful golf course. Less than an hour’s drive will take you to Château Rochfoucauld in Jarnac, the Pierre Loti Museum in Rochefort and the beach of Royan.

Program
Sunday to Friday inclusive (6 days)
9:00-13:30 sculpting with supervision
13:30-14:30 extensive hot lunch
14:30-18:00 sculpting with supervision / time off to discover the region

How to get there
You can easily reach Cherves Richemont by car (approx. 5 hours from Paris). You will receive detailed directions. From Paris, you can reach Cognac by train in about 3 ½ hours (via Angoulême). You can fly from a great number of British and Irish cities to La Rochelle or Bordeaux. The train will take you via Saintes to Cognac. For participants arriving by train/plane, we can arrange transport from Cognac train station to La Montée.

Prices
Cost per course: € 475,- per person. Price includes tools, machinery, specialized equipment, coffee, tea, mineral water, soft drinks and 6 extensive hot lunches with wine. Not included are travelling cost, accommodation and materials. All materials can be bought at cost price.
